US 42 is now expected to remain closed between Horseshoe Rd. and the city of Delaware until the end of December due to the wet weather last month. Crews are making progress towards the finish line of this emergency project.

In May, the District Six office of the Ohio Department of Transportation shared news via Facebook and on OHGO.com, the state’s real-time traffic advisory system, that US42 had been closed at SR37 until further notice for “emergency repairs.

A few days later, ODOT revealed the nature of that emergency — a giant sinkhole. According to the department, it has been working with the Ohio Department of Natural Resources, Delaware County Emergency Management, and the City of Delaware to plan and execute repairs.
